Disadvantages of RAID 1 Uses only … WebRAID 50 (sometimes referred to as RAID 5+0) combines multiple RAID 5 sets (striping with parity) with RAID 0 (striping) (Figures 9 and Figure 10). The benefits of RAID 5 are gained while the spanned RAID 0 allows the incorporation of many more drives into a single logical disk. Up to one drive in each sub-array may fail without loss of data.

WebApr 6, 2024 · RAID 10 has multiple mirrored disks, and RAID 50 has more disks per sub-array allowing 1 disk per sub-array to be fault-tolerant. RAID 60 is very much the same except 2 disks can fail in the sub-array. Nested RAID levels require many disks and the available disk capacity ranges from 50% up to 80% depending on the number of disks. WebAug 23, 2024 · RAID 10 and RAID 01 provide identical capacities and performance, and both architectures have the same amount of storage overhead, prioritizing redundancy over capacity. The difference is that RAID 10 provides better fault tolerance in most cases because it is not limited to two groups. WebFeb 3, 2016 · RAID 10. RAID level 10, also written as “1+0”, combines the techniques and benefits of levels 1 and 0. In RAID 10, you configure multiple RAID 1 mirrored disk sets, then join them into a single logical RAID 0 drive. For example, with four drives, you create two sets of Level 1 RAID logical drives consisting of two physical drives each.
